Question
I am planing to try ice fishing for the first time in Banff, Canada.
What lure should I use?

Answer
Greetings,

Typically the best thing to use ice fishing is live bait.

Minnows work best for Walleye and Pike. Wax worms are usually the ticket for pan fish.

There are many very special jigs for pan fish too.

Your best bet would be to hire a local guide or go with someone experienced in the local waters.
